An increasing number of security solution providers now offer managed security services. It's a trend that could pay dividends for your solution provider company. But before you can just dive right in, you should become acquainted with the managed security services landscape and all of its nuances.

Small customer companies often do not have extensive internal resources to devote to security. Ever-changing compliance regulations are difficult to keep up with when resources are tight. For these reasons, companies often must turn to managed security service providers to take care of their security needs.

This isn't, however, a business venture to enter into lightly. There are many challenges to be aware of before getting started.
